Reaction of activated vinyl halides with tervalent phosphorus nucleophiles
Abstract
cis- and trans- Isomers of derivatives of 3-halogenoacrylic acids undergo nucleophilic displacement reactions with triphenylphosphine, tri-n-butylphosphine, and triethyl phosphite to produce the correspondingtrans-vinyl-phosphonium salts and -phosphonates exclusively. 1H n.m.r.spectra are reported for these compounds. The mechanism of the displacement reaction is discussed.
